/** * Create a schema which verifies only that an object is of the given format. * @param format the format to expect * @return the schema verifying the given format */ public static JsonSchema minimalForFormat(JsonFormatTypes format) { if (format != null) { switch (format) { case ARRAY: return new ArraySchema(); case OBJECT: return new ObjectSchema(); case BOOLEAN: return new BooleanSchema(); case INTEGER: return new IntegerSchema(); case NUMBER: return new NumberSchema(); case STRING: return new StringSchema(); case NULL: return new NullSchema(); case ANY: default: } } return new AnySchema(); }
